Assigning Data Type Rights to User Roles

Location: User Roles (task ID: UserRoleMnt) > Data Type Permissions

With data type permissions admin user may restrict access rights for certain data type for users who by licence type have general read/write access (normal/input users). On the Data Type Permissions tab, select the permissions you want to assign to a role from the drop-down lists in the Permissions column.

  • Read/write permission: Users with this role can view data entered to the data type and enter data to it.

  • Read permission: Users with this role can view data entered to the data type.

  • No permissions: Users with this role cannot enter data to the data type or view data entered to it.

If a user has several roles, the most unrestrictive permissions apply. For example, if a user has four roles, one of which has 'Read/write permission' for the data type, one 'Read permission' and two 'No permissions', 'Read/write permission' applies. For a user to have no permissions for a data type, all of the user's roles must have 'No permissions' for it.
